The trouble with the M-Mobility kit (I also had with my '03 M5) is that it expires after some time (2-4 yr?) and needs to be replaced, even if not used. Even if that were not true (e.g. some drugs can work well after expiration date), would you want to chance it when you need to depend on it? Also, although I never did get to use it, I heard it can really mess up the inside of the wheel, especially one with TPMS sensors. I also have AAA and the BMW Roadside Assistance (as you probably do as well). Originally Posted by Nahoa View Post
The studded tires are a bit of overkill with so little snow, no?
Studs are not really meant for snow. They are there for the ice underneath. Cold, wind and snow ends up making a nice slippery ice layer over the tarmac.

I have studded Hakka 7, and I live in Quebec, so I understand the need to have studs. The difference between studded and stud less Hakka 7s (tried both) is to be tried to believe !
